Study the given histogram that shows the marks obtained by students in an examination and answer the question that follows. The number of students who obtained less than 350 marks is what per cent more than the number of students who obtained 400 or more marks? (correct to one decimal place) Correct Answer 385.7%
Number of student obtained less than 350 = (30 + 45 + 60 + 35) = 170
Number of student obtained 400 or more = 35
⇒ Difference between number of students obtained less than 350 and number of students obtained 400 or more = (170 - 35) = 135
Percentage = 135/35 × 100 = 385.714% ≈ 385.7%
∴ Required percentage is 385.7%
